At one point, forces are applied: F1 = 15 НF2 = 24 НF3 = 19 НF4 = 20 N. Determine their resultant (vector sum) for the case when: a) all these forces act along one straight line in one direction; b) all these forces act along one straight line, but F1 and F2 in one direction, and F3 and F4 in the other.

Given:

F1 = 15 Newton;

F2 = 24 Newtons;

F3 = 19 Newton;

F4 = 20 Newtons.

It is required to determine the resultant forces F (Newton) in the following cases:

a) all forces act along one straight line in one direction;

b) all forces act along one straight line, but F1 and F2 in one direction, and F3 and F4 in the other

Let us find the resultant forces for case a):

F = F1 + F2 + F3 + F4 = 15 + 24 + 19 + 20 = 78 Newtons.

Let us find the resultant of the forces for case b, while we agree that F1 and F2 act in the positive direction of the coordinate axis, and F3 and F4 in the negative direction.

F = F1 + F2 – F3 – F4 = 15 + 24 – 19 – 20 = 0 Newton.

Answer: the resultant forces in case a will be equal to 78 Newton, in case b – 0 Newton.
